What are DRO & Impact Forces of South Africa Vehicle Electrification Market?
Drivers include government policy shifts favoring clean energy, notably the proposed transition to EV manufacturing mandates and decreasing battery costs globally. Restraints involve significant challenges related to the national electricity grid stability, high initial vehicle purchase prices for consumers, and limited charging infrastructure outside major metropolitan areas. Opportunities exist in localizing battery assembly and developing specialized electrification solutions for the mining and commercial fleet sectors.
What is Impact of US Tariffs on South Africa Vehicle Electrification Market?
While direct U.S. tariffs on South African manufactured EVs are minimal due to low trade volumes, the indirect impact is felt through complex global supply chains. Tariffs imposed by the U.S. on components sourced from key Asian manufacturing hubs raise the cost of essential EV inputs, such as specialized semiconductor chips and lithium-ion cells, increasing the final assembly cost for vehicles intended for domestic sale or export. This inflationary pressure affects market accessibility and profitability.
How is AI currently impacting South Africa Vehicle Electrification Market?
Artificial Intelligence is primarily impacting the sector through enhanced battery management systems (BMS) for optimizing range and longevity, and improving the efficiency of charging networks. AI algorithms facilitate predictive maintenance for critical EV components, reducing downtime and operational costs for fleet operators. Furthermore, AI assists in dynamic load balancing within smart charging infrastructure to minimize stress on the constrained national power grid.
